Butane is a hydrocarbon gas that is commonly used as a fuel for torches, lighters, and camping stoves. It is stored in pressurized canisters, which are designed to hold the gas safely under normal conditions. However, if the canisters are exposed to extreme temperatures, physical damage, or improper handling, they can pose a significant risk.<\/p>\n<h3>Choosing the Right Storage Location<\/h3>\n<p>The first step in storing butane canisters is to choose the right location. Here are some key considerations:<\/p>\n<h4>Cool and Dry Environment<\/h4>\n<p>Butane canisters should be stored in a cool and dry place. High temperatures can cause the pressure inside the canister to increase, which may lead to leaks or even explosions. A temperature range between 10\u00b0C and 30\u00b0C (50\u00b0F and 86\u00b0F) is ideal. Avoid storing the canisters in direct sunlight, near heat sources such as radiators or stoves, or in areas prone to high humidity.<\/p>\n<h4>Well &#8211; Ventilated Area<\/h4>\n<p>Proper ventilation is crucial when storing butane canisters. In case of a leak, the gas needs to be able to disperse safely. A well &#8211; ventilated area helps prevent the accumulation of butane gas, which can be explosive. Avoid storing the canisters in enclosed spaces like closets or basements without proper ventilation. A garage or a shed with good air circulation is a better option, as long as it meets the other storage requirements.<\/p>\n<h4>Away from Ignition Sources<\/h4>\n<p>Butane is highly flammable, so it&#8217;s important to keep the canisters away from any potential ignition sources. This includes open flames, electrical appliances that can produce sparks, and smoking areas. Make sure the storage location is at a safe distance from these hazards to minimize the risk of fire.<\/p>\n<h3>Storage Containers<\/h3>\n<p>Using the right storage container can add an extra layer of safety. Avoid dropping or banging the canisters, as this can damage the valve or the container itself, leading to leaks. Make sure your hands are clean and dry when handling the canisters to prevent any contaminants from getting into the valve.<\/p>\n<h4>Stacking<\/h4>\n<p>If you need to stack the butane canisters, do it carefully. Stack them in a stable manner to prevent them from toppling over. Avoid stacking them too high, as this can increase the risk of damage. It&#8217;s also a good idea to place a non &#8211; slip mat or a layer of padding at the bottom of the stack to provide additional stability.<\/p>\n<h3>Regular Inspections<\/h3>\n<p>Regular inspections of the butane canisters are necessary to ensure their safety.<\/p>\n<h4>Visual Inspection<\/h4>\n<p>Check the canisters regularly for any signs of damage, such as dents, rust, or leaks. Look for any signs of corrosion around the valve area. If you notice any damage, do not use the canister and dispose of it properly according to local regulations.<\/p>\n<h4>Valve Inspection<\/h4>\n<p>Inspect the valve of the canister to make sure it is in good working condition. Check for any signs of leakage by applying a soapy water solution to the valve. If you see bubbles forming, it indicates a leak. In case of a leak, do not attempt to repair the canister yourself. Instead, follow the proper disposal procedures.<\/p>\n<h3>Disposal of Butane Canisters<\/h3>\n<p>When a butane canister is empty or damaged, it needs to be disposed of properly.<\/p>\n<h4>Empty Canisters<\/h4>\n<p>Empty butane canisters can usually be recycled. However, it&#8217;s important to make sure they are completely empty before recycling. To empty the canister, use it until the torch no longer produces a flame. Then, let the canister cool down and follow the local recycling guidelines.<\/p>\n<h4>Damaged Canisters<\/h4>\n<p>Damaged canisters should never be reused. Contact your local waste management facility or hazardous waste disposal service for instructions on how to dispose of them safely. Do not throw damaged canisters in the regular trash, as this can pose a serious safety risk.<\/p>\n<h3>Safety Precautions<\/h3>\n<p>In addition to the above storage and handling tips, here are some general safety precautions to keep in mind:<\/p>\n<h4>Keep Out of Reach of Children<\/h4>\n<p>Butane canisters are dangerous if mishandled, so keep them out of the reach of children.
